SopCast Player is a Linux GUI front-end for the p2p streaming technology developed by SopCast. SopCast can play various TV channels (watch football games, HBO, AXN Movie and so on) for free, using the internet.


Here is how to install the latest SopCast Player 0.4 in Ubuntu 10.04 Lucid Lynx.


1. You must download libstdc++ manually because this package is not included in the Ubuntu repositories. Don't worry, you can use these .deb files:
ftp.de.debian.org/debian/pool/main/g/gcc...+5_3.3.6-18_i386.deb
ftp.de.debian.org/debian/pool/main/g/gcc...5_3.3.6-18_amd64.deb

Add the SopCast Player PPA and install SopCast Player:
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:ferramroberto/extra && sudo apt-get update
sudo apt-get install sopcast-player sp-auth

And that's it, now go to Applications > Sound & Video > SopCast Player.


Note: SopCast Player requires VLC < 1.1.0 (VLC version lower than 1.1.0).
